Every inbound request must carry a propagated trace header; services that drop it break span correlation in the Lanternview dashboard. Before modifying any service middleware, review the Tracewell propagation contract and confirm changes with the platform team. Invoices and contract questions go through procurement, but technical tracing issues should reach the vendor liaison directly.

alerts address for kajef-bagap: istax.fraath@zemvarcorp.corp

Heads up, plugin folks: the Mapwick tile cache sits between your renderer and the Glyphstone store, so cold starts are way faster. It evicts on a 6-hour TTL by default. To let your plugin write to the shared cache, your env file needs this credential line right here.

env line for baguf-fajop: VAULT_KEY29=55a9f564d54882bbe7acf5741bf1a

## Changelog — Crashloom 7.3

For the weekly sync: the crash-report pipeline setting `UPLOAD_KEY` is renamed to `CRASHLOOM_INGEST_SECRET` to stop collisions with the mobile build system's identically named variable, which caused symbol uploads from the Quarrow app to land in the wrong project. The old name still works through 7.5 with a startup warning. Deployments should update their env files now; the renamed entry goes on the line immediately after this note.

env line for fafof-fahag: LEDGER_TOKEN5=f8790

Quick handover on Shrinkwrap, our batch image-resize CLI. Mira got the parallel worker pool stable; just don't bump concurrency past 8 on the build boxes. Release signing runs through the Tobbler vault. If the vault session expires mid-release, re-auth needs the recovery passphrase, which is kept right below for the on-call person.

vault phrase of tajop-haduf = holath-brivan-wenax

Charsniff, our encoding-detection service for uploaded text files, ships on a two-week cadence. Each release bundles the detection tables, the confidence-scoring model, and the fallback heuristics for legacy code pages. Before the weekly eng sync, the release owner tags the build, runs the regression corpus (about 40k sample files), and posts results to the Driftholm dashboard. All release artifacts must be signed prior to publishing to the internal registry. Verification happens automatically at deploy time using the key shown here:

rollout seal: bky4_x7Gc